    An explicit symplectic integration scheme which describes the selfconsistent wave particle interaction is developed. The integrator does not split the Hamiltonian trivially into a kinetic and potential part. The integrator yields accurate growth rates for the gentle-bump instability even when the timestep is of the order of the inverse plasma frequency. This represents up to a tenfold reduction in computation compared to conventional schemes.
